Common Residential & Commercial Roofing Scams in Snyder
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Storm Chaser Scam
Uninvited out-of-towners swarm after storms, lowball quotes, grab deposits, then ghost or butcher the job.
Upfront Payment Trap
Insist on 50%+ cash upfront, then start slow or vanish.
Hidden Damage Bait-and-Switch
Low initial quote, then 'discover' issues mid-job for huge add-ons.
Cheap Materials Switch
Promise premium shingles, deliver junk that leaks soon.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request certificates for general liability ($1M+) and workers' comp. Call the listed insurer to confirm active coverage—no excuses.
Licensing
Oklahoma requires roofing licenses from the Construction Industries Board (CIB) for jobs over $10,000. Verify free at cib.ok.gov using name or license number.
References
Get 3+ recent Snyder or Kiowa County job references. Call to confirm quality, timelines, and full payment.
